Factors to Consider When Choosing Back Door Installers
To ensure that the installation of your back door is managed correctly, it’s vital to thoroughly consider your alternatives. Here are some elements to keep in mind when choosing reliable back entrance installers:
1. Experience and Expertise
- Try to find installers who have a solid track record in your neighborhood and substantial experience in door installation. They must be familiar with numerous kinds of doors, including steel, fiberglass, and wood.
2. Licenses and Insurance
- Any reputable installer needs to be effectively licensed and insured. This protects you from liability in case of mishaps and guarantees that the work satisfies required local structure codes.
3. Consumer Reviews and References
- Examine online reviews on platforms like Google and Yelp. You can likewise request for references from previous clients to get firsthand accounts of their experiences.
4. Service Offerings
- Make sure that the installer uses a comprehensive variety of services, consisting of door choices, custom fitting, and post-installation service, such as upkeep or repair work.
5. Pricing
- While it can be tempting to opt for the most affordable bid, concentrate on value for cash. Quality setups frequently come at a greater price, but this usually relates to durability and dependability.
6. Professionalism and Communication
- Assess the installer’s responsiveness and professionalism throughout your preliminary interactions. Reliable communication is vital for an effective project.
7. Extra Services
- Some installers may provide extra services, such as door security improvements or custom painting and staining to match your home’s looks.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. The length of time does it require to install a back entrance?
The installation time varies depending upon the type of door and the complexity of the project, but normally, a professional installer can finish the task in a couple of hours.
2. What type of door is best for a back entry?
Fiberglass doors are popular for back entries due to their durability and energy efficiency. Nevertheless, wood doors can offer visual appeal, while steel doors use improved security.

3. Can I set up a back door myself?
While it is possible, working with a professional is recommended for optimum outcomes. Do it yourself installations might cause errors, impacting the door’s performance and durability.
4. What should I look for in a quote?
A detailed quote needs to consist of the cost of the door, labor, cleanup, and any extra products needed for installation. Avoid quotes that appear unusually low, as they might stint quality.
5. How can I look after my new back entrance?
Routine upkeep, such as cleaning and examining weather condition stripping, can extend the life of your door. Consider applying a sealant or paint to secure it from the components if it’s made from wood.
